The ingredients needed to make Broiled lamb kebabs:
  1. Make ready 6 Pounds Boneless Lamb Shoulder
  2. Take 2 Tbsp Cumin
  3. Prepare 1 Tbsp Coriander (Optional)
  4. Take 1 Medium-Large Onion
  5. Take 1 Tbsp Black Pepper
  6. Get 1/3 Cup Olive Oil
  7. Get 1/2 Bunch Leaf Parsley
  8. Get 1 Tbsp Beef or chicken Flavored
  9. Prepare Salt as you needed

Steps to make Broiled lamb kebabs:
  1. Cut the lamb into roughly 2 by 2 inch pieces. Use a food processor to chop the onion and parsley. Then mix all of that with cumin, coriander, salt, black pepper and olive oil.
  2. Pour over the lamb pieces then proceed to mix it by hand until thoroughly mixed. Cover with plastic wrap and chill it in the refrigerator overnight, or for at least 4 hours.
  3. Remove the meat from the refrigerator and thread them onto skewers. Cook under an oven broiler for about 5-7 minutes each side. Serve with basmati rice or pita bread together with Greek tzatziki sauce on the side. Enjoy!
